#ad3906 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ad3906 is composed of 67.8% red, 22.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 18.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 35.1%. #ad3906 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ff720c with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#ad3906 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#ad3906 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ad3906 has RGB values of R:173, G:57,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.97,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11352326.

Shades and Tints of #ad3906

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ef3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#ad3906

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5959 is the less saturated color, while #ad3906 is the most saturated one.
